在实际项目开发中,特别是分布式项目,往往有N多个子项目需要同时启动测试。

这一切靠本地安装的tomcat是远远不够的,而且繁琐。

这里就需要用到tomca插件。

在pom.xml中引入:

 <build>
<plugins>
<plugin>
<groupId>org.apache.tomcat.maven</groupId>
<artifactId>tomcat7-maven-plugin</artifactId>
<version>2.2</version>
<configuration>
<!-- 指定端口 -->
<port>7000</port>
<!-- 请求路径 -->
<path>/</path>
<!--这个名称需要,在maven插件中显示应用名称-->
<server>tomcat7</server>
</configuration>
</plugin>
</plugins>
</build>

然后在项目的右侧,找到mavenprojects启动

这样多个项目引用Tomcat插件,配置不同的端口,就可以同时启动N个项目了。

报错:Failed to initialize end point associated with ProtocolHandler ["http-bio-10000"]

表示该端口被占用,重新设置一个端口就可以了。

同样,右键选择 DEBUG 进入调试。

最新文章

  1. [计算机网络]简易http server程序
  2. ubuntu 12.04 install docker-engine1.12.3
  3. EF中的开放式并发(EF基础系列--28)
  4. [转] Linux下 config/configure/Configure、make 、make test/make check、sudo make install 的作用
  5. Lingo 做线性规划 - DEA
  6. ctrl+z暂停任务
  7. python之函数式编程
  8. JavaScript网站设计实践(六)编写live.html页面 改进表格显示
  9. ulimit -n修改单进程可打开最大文件数目
  10. spring 自动化构建项目
  11. [LeetCode] Wildcard Matching 题解
  12. React 特性剪辑(版本 16.0 ~ 16.9)
  13. WPF常用布局介绍
  14. .net core Identity集成IdentityServer(3) 一键登出
  15. QML学习笔记(三)-引入Font-awesome
  16. 【iCore3应用】基于iCore3双核心板的编码器应用实例
  17. linux git 安装方法
  18. 运行java飞行记录器JFR(java flight recorder)
  19. WebLogic 12c Linux 命令行 安装
  20. 很有用的高级 Git 命令

热门文章

  1. test20190731 夏令营NOIP训练16
  2. Appium环境搭建(Mac)
  3. 基于Python3+Requests的贴吧签到助手
  4. SP1825 【FTOUR2 - Free tour II】
  5. Dubbbo
  6. Apache Kylin v3.0.0-alpha 发布
  7. snmp-trap
  8. Problem 1 bfs+set
  9. POJ 1927 Area in Triangle
  10. ehcache 配置说明